BOYLE v. CITY OF NEW YORK

3289, 17227/02.

79 A.D.3d 664 (2010)

914 N.Y.S.2d 126

WILLIAM BOYLE et al., Respondents-Appellants, v. CITY OF NEW YORK, Defendant and Third-Party Plaintiff. HOUGEN MANUFACTURING, INC., Third-Party Defendant-Appellant-Respondent.

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of New York, First Department.

Decided December 28, 2010.


With regard to the strict products liability causes of action based on design and manufacturing defects, the motion was correctly denied. Hougen failed to meet its initial burden of establishing prima facie entitlement to judgment as a matter of law.
